Callinf

Callinf

The detector runs as a browser overlay, captures the audio from whatever tab is playing the call, and scores three independent signals — AI phrasing patterns, spontaneity, and what the docs call 'bookishness' — combining them into a single probability dial. Transcription happens either locally in the browser via Whisper or through Groq cloud, depending on which engine you pick. File upload for recorded calls is a paid-only feature. The tool is honest about its limits: the vendor explicitly states the score is a probabilistic hint, not evidence. Teams doing due diligence on recorded interviews get the same analysis pipeline on uploaded video and audio files.

Whissle Gateway

Whissle Gateway

Whissle's Stream2Action architecture feeds audio, text, or video through a single-pass discriminative model — META-1 — and returns structured JSON carrying transcription, speaker diarization, emotion, intent, age, gender, and entities simultaneously. The full stack (ASR, LLM, TTS, diarization) runs self-hosted on a single GPU via Docker, which is the core production story here. The cloud API is documented as temporarily down while on-prem infrastructure is reinforced, so teams who need cloud failover have no fallback path right now. Video input is on a stated roadmap; text streaming arrives next. For contact center or privacy-sensitive workloads where you control the hardware, the on-prem path is active — for anything cloud-dependent, you are waiting.
